Former captain Babar Azam and current ODI skipper Mohammed Rizwan have been downgraded to category 'B' in the latest list of central contracts released by the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) on Tuesday.

The PCB, in fact, has not found any cricketer fit to be in the elite category and has placed 30 players in Category 'B', 'C' and 'D'.

"The contracts, effective from July 1, 2025, through June 30, 2026, reflect the Board's continued commitment to recognising and supporting national talent. This year's roster sees ten players each placed in Categories B, C, and D. Notably, no player has been selected for Category A in this cycle," PCB stated in a media release.

The PCB release doesn't mention the valuation of the contracts.
